Easter Island is one of the most isolated places on Earth, being situated in the
South Pacific 2,000 miles from the nearest population centres in Tahiti and
Chile. It is best known for the giant stone monoliths, known as Moai, along its
coastline. Admiral Roggeveen, who came upon the island on Easter Day in 1722,
named it Easter Island. Today the land, the people of the island, and its
language, are all referred to locally as Rapa Nui.
